Understanding SMS Activation Platforms
SMS activation services function as intermediaries in the digital verification process. When a user registers for a new service, such as a social media account, a payment processor, or a messaging application, that platform often sends a one-time password (OTP) via SMS to verify the user identity. Virtual number platforms provide a pool of phone numbers that can receive these incoming text messages, store the content within a user dashboard, and allow the user to retrieve the confirmation code instantly. This decentralized approach removes the physical necessity of owning multiple SIM cards or mobile devices, which would be impractical and cost-prohibitive for high-volume account management.
The technical infrastructure behind these services relies on sophisticated telecommunications routing. These providers maintain agreements with mobile network operators across various jurisdictions to lease large batches of phone numbers. When an incoming message reaches these numbers, the platform utilizes proprietary software to parse the data and display it in the user interface corresponding to their specific rental or one-time use request. While the process appears seamless, it constitutes a complex interaction between global telecom networks, cloud-based data storage, and automated web scraping or API interfaces designed to deliver verification data at scale.

Cons and Risks to Consider
Despite their utility, these services are not without significant drawbacks. The most prominent issue involves the reputation of the phone numbers provided. Major online services like Google, WhatsApp, or Twitter continuously update their fraud detection algorithms to identify and blacklist numbers originating from low-reputation or known virtual number ranges. If a phone number has been used previously by many other users, it is highly likely to be flagged or rejected by the destination platform, rendering the purchased number useless. This instability requires users to be prepared for failed verifications and potential loss of credits.
Reliability is another major concern. Because these platforms rely on the cooperation of third-party telecom providers in various parts of the world, connectivity can be inconsistent. Messages may be delayed, incomplete, or never delivered at all. This lack of control over the underlying telecom infrastructure means that users are at the mercy of network stability in the country of the number being used. In scenarios where a time-sensitive verification code is required, such as during a high-stakes account recovery or a security patch implementation, this latency can be catastrophic to the workflow.
Finally, there is the matter of account longevity. Many services that require SMS verification also employ proactive monitoring. If they detect that a registered account is associated with a virtual or shared number, they may perform a secondary verification or even automatically ban the account without prior warning. This creates a risk for businesses relying on these accounts for long-term operations. Users often find that these numbers are only suitable for short-term tasks or one-off registrations rather than for building permanent, mission-critical account infrastructures.

Security and Privacy Implications
Using third-party SMS services introduces inherent security risks. When you use a virtual number, you are effectively trusting a middleman with access to your security codes. If the service is compromised or if it maintains poor security practices, your verification codes could be intercepted by malicious actors. Once an attacker has access to your SMS verification, they may attempt to perform a login, reset a password, or initiate secondary authentication procedures on your accounts. This level of access is rarely an issue with standard services, but it is a genuine threat in the context of high-security finance or personal data accounts.
Furthermore, privacy is a major concern. When you sign up for these platforms, you are generally required to provide some level of personal information for billing, and in some jurisdictions, services may keep logs of who accessed which specific phone number. Users who prioritize anonymity should look for services that provide minimal data retention, transparent privacy policies, and the ability to pay using privacy-preserving methods. It is also important to consider the legal environment, as some countries impose strict regulations on virtual telecom providers, and using such services could potentially violate the terms of service of the target platform you are accessing.

Technical Integration and Automation
For those looking to build scalable systems, technical integration is the foundation of success. The best platforms provide an API that allows a developer to programmatically request a number for a specific service, receive the incoming SMS, and perform an action based on that content. This eliminates the need to manually click through a web dashboard, which is essential for workflows that require thousands of accounts to be managed simultaneously. Automation scripts written in Python, Node.js, or Go can interface directly with these APIs, enabling a fully hands-off account management system.
When integrating these services, it is important to handle exceptions properly. Since no service is 100 percent reliable, your code should be written to detect when a number is not working, report the failure to the service provider, and request a new number automatically. This “auto-failover” logic is what separates a professional, resilient system from a fragile, manual one. Additionally, developers should implement rate limiting to stay within the guidelines of both the activation service and the target platform, as aggressive automated activity can lead to an immediate ban or IP blocking regardless of the number provider used.
Scalability remains an ongoing challenge even with advanced automation. As you increase the number of accounts managed, you must monitor the state of each. This involves tracking account age, verification history, and any flags raised by the target platform. Managing this metadata in a local database, paired with the unique identifiers provided by the SMS service, allows you to maintain clean account health data. This level of rigor is necessary for enterprise environments where digital assets have real value, and their loss could represent a significant business impact.
Finally, maintenance intervals should be incorporated into the automation loop. Over time, service providers may change their API endpoints, pricing, or the structure of their responses. Regularly auditing the integration and ensuring that your code accounts for API changes is a standard requirement for long-term project stability.
